Cogan station provides several basic amenities to ensure a smooth travel experience. While there isn't a ticket office, the station is equipped with ticket machines for easy purchase and collection, also supporting online buys via card payment. The machines are fitted with induction loops to assist the hearing impaired. For those wondering about a quick stop for refreshments or cash, note that the station doesn't host shops, ATMs, or currency exchange services currently.
In terms of accessibility, Cogan station presents a mixed scenario. There is step-free access to Platform 1 (for Barry-bound trains) from the car park. However, reaching Platform 2 (towards Cardiff) involves using a 44-step footbridge, presenting a challenge for those with mobility issues. Despite the absence of staff help in-person, a helpline accessible anytime assists in arranging travel support, ensuring passengers can travel confidently.
Beyond rail travel, Cogan station provides a seamless transition to other modes of transportation. The Rail Replacement Service stops right within the station car park. For eco-friendly travelers, bicycle hire services are catered by Next/Ovo bike just to the south at Penarth Leisure Centre. Kemble Train Station is equipped to handle your ticketing needs efficiently. The ticket office operates from 06:30 to 13:00 on weekdays and from 07:30 to 14:00 on Saturdays. There's also a ticket machine for quick and convenient ticket collection anytime. For those using smartcards, validators are available, ensuring smooth travel transitions. Accessibility is thoughtfully considered at Kemble – featuring accessible ticket machines, induction loops, and step-free access in several areas of the station.
Looking for comfort before your journey? Kemble Station provides seating areas and waiting rooms, operational from 06:40 to 13:30 on weekdays and slightly adjusted on weekends. Although the station lacks ATMs and public Wi-Fi, you'll find refreshment facilities and shops to cater to last-minute needs. For those traveling with bicycles, there are stands with CCTV monitoring outside the station.
